In the Splunk App for PCI Compliance, why are my PCI Dashboards without data?

Hi all,

I have installed the PCI module, and I have followed the implementation steps (https://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/PCI/3.7.2/Install/ConfigurePCIDSSDomains), but I do not get any data in the PCI dashboards — any clue?

I have the following scenario:

1 splunk server with PCI app installed, with IP xxx.xxx.204.136

1 Domain controller (win 2012) with IP xxx.xxx.204.200 (the domain is mydomain.com)

1 Windows server with a splunk forwarder IP xxx.xxx.204.199; I have deployed

I have ADD data from a Splunk forwarder, and I have selected sources Local Events Source (Applications, Forwarder events, security, setup and system), one by one with PCI index.

In Splunk, I have uploaded the assets via CSV file, and I can see in the App PCI - Assets Center :

ip,mac,nt_host,dns,owner,priority,lat,long,city,country,bunit,category,pci_domain,is_expected,should_timesync,should_update,requires_av

xxx.xxx.204.199,00:0C:29:24:0F:88,WINSRV2012FW,,imontano,high,,,Dallas,USA,americas,pci,untrust,false,false,false,false

In Splunk, I have uploaded the identities via a CSV file, and I can see in the App PCI - Identity Center :

identity,prefix,nick,first,last,suffix,email,phone,phone2,managedBy,priority,bunit,category,watchlist,startDate,endDate,work_city,work_country,work_lat,work_long

imontano,Mr,imontano,ivan,montano,,imontano@mydomain.com,44199,44199,imontano,high,americas,pci,false,,,Dallas,USA,37.3382,121.8863

When I go to the PCI Compliance Posture, I can see all the indicators in green without data.

In Notable Events By Owner — Last 24 Hours, over owner I got "unassigned," but I have configured the assets and identities.

Any clues?

AFAIK, these dashboards are filled solely with data from "notable events". To create these events you have to enable the corresponding correlation searches in the App's configuration.
